Transaction b51b1558848779d95dd61f6ec5e00f5640c3e19b68c626241870bd5d53d2f81f

5 Input
2 Outputs
  • b51b1558848779d95dd61f6ec5e00f5640c3e19b68c626241870bd5d53d2f81f:0
  • value  65000000
    address  34Wy373yCDswftiW62qWxaHK3spRt1v6aS
  • b51b1558848779d95dd61f6ec5e00f5640c3e19b68c626241870bd5d53d2f81f:1
  • value  69489164
    address  3BMEXxk7gV1483h2f4MnfweVmvX6X9hNNQ